• What is Los Angeles Ride for Autism? We are 100% volunteer group dedicated to raising funds benefiting non?profit entities that are directly involved with the AutismSpectrum Disorder, by organizing motorcycle fun rides in Southern California
• Our first Los Angeles Autism Ride was in 2005
• Incorporated and became a 501(c) (3) organization in the city of Pico Rivera in December 2008
• Started with three board members: Anthony de la Rosa, Pat de la Rosa and Doug Marrone. Pat and Anthony are parents of Brissa, a 12 year old girl with Autism.Doug is an avid motorcyclist and passionate about this cause.
• Ride For Autism has grown from 80 riders starting in 2005 to over 500 riders and 750 attendees in total by 2009
• Our fundraising efforts have generated over $200,000 on behalf of Autism in the Los Angeles area.
